2. LOCATION OF UNIT
Using a stud nder, locate the wall 
studs to be used for mounting, and 
mark height of the center of cabinet 
on stud where unit will be mounted. 
Locate the existing wiring or other 
utilities in the wall to prevent drilling 
into/severing a wire and/or other utility 
during installation.
Make sure your desired mounting 
location has adequate clearance for 
ironing. The cabinet door opens at 180 
degrees; allow 16” from side of cabinet 
for door to open. Refer to chart below 
for needed space.
1. DETERMINE MOUNTING HEIGHT
Using the charts provided, determine 
the mounting height above oor (the 
distance between the oor and the 
bottom of the cabinet). First choose 
your desired ironing board height 
from the left column, then locate the 
corresponding mounting height in the 
right column.

TOOLS NEEDED:
- Stud Finder
- 12-14” Level
- Tape Measure
- Small Flathead 
 Screwdriver
- Electric Drill 
 (with 1/4” & 1/8” drill bit)
- 1/4” Nut Driver 
 (optional)
- Safety Glasses
- Utility Knife
